Effects of Benthic Burrows on Hyporheic Exchange
Abstract Macrobenthic invertebrates are widely distributed on sediments, and the micro‐morphology such as burrows and sand mounds due to their bioturbation activities can cause substantial changes in hyporheic exchange (HE).
